NeeD HELP ASAP ! Please. the function f(x)=x^2. The graph of g(x) is f(x) translated to the right 3units and down 3 units what is the function rule for g(x) ? Please show me step by step

1 Answer

2 votes

Answer:

g(x) = (x-3) ^2 -3

Explanation:

f(x) = x^2

To shift down 3 units, subtract 3 ( When we move up, we add)

h(x) = x^2 -3

To shift to the right 3 units, replace x with (x-3). I know it seems backwards, but right is minus and left is plus.

g(x) = (x-3) ^2 -3
